The __________ is the main control center for the autonomic nervous system. A. forebrain B. thalamus C. hypothalamus D. cerebrum
nirvana33 [79]
The autonomic nervous system (ANS) is the part of the nervous system which is involuntary. It is composed of neurons that is responsible for impulsing the central nervous system to muscles and glands. The hypothalamus is the most important part and main control center of ANS. It is responsible for many homeostatic processes inside our body. Both the autonomic function and the endocrine function is regulated by the hypothalamus.
